**Q: How does the retention sweeper in Cobblewick decide what to delete?**

A: Policy tables only. The sweeper reads retention windows from the Dunmarsh policy store, marks expired rows, waits one cycle, then purges. No hardcoded durations — reject any PR that adds them. Dry-run mode is default in staging; purge mode requires an explicit flag. Reviewers should confirm the flag is gated behind the ceremony check. To inspect the sweeper's sealed audit log, authenticate with the passphrase given below.

recovery phrase for tajop-kawep: belox-joreth-ulaox-novael

## Recovery Notes — ProctorLine Queue Admin

Heads up: if the ProctorLine exam queue admin account gets locked (usually after a failed bulk reschedule), don't just reset it through the Bramwick SSO portal — that desyncs the queue workers and they'll drop in-flight exam sessions. Instead, use the local recovery flow on the queue coordinator box. It walks you through re-seeding the session table first, then asks you to confirm your identity. At the final prompt, enter the recovery passphrase noted below.

vault phrase of bagaf-kajeg = jorath-feniel-briir-siliel-ralix

- [ ] **Step 7: Breaker override escrow.** After sealing the signing keys for the Tallgrove upstream API circuit breaker, confirm the support team can force the breaker open during a full outage. The override bundle lives in the sealed escrow drawer and is useless without its unlock phrase. Two ceremony witnesses must initial this step before proceeding. The escrow bundle is decrypted with the recovery passphrase that follows.

vault phrase of kahip-kahop = holath-quenmir